Malcolm McDowell looks back on Wing Commander to promote RA3 Uprising


Actor Malcolm McDowell is no stranger to being in live-action video game movie sequences. Fans of the Wing Commander series may remember him playing the role of Admiral Tolwyn. A lot has changed since the 90's, the least of which being the huge leap to HD video technology, which is clearly demonstrated in this video. Now McDowell returns to video games in Red Alert 3 - Uprising as Rupert Thornley, president of the European Union. Uprising is a available now exclusively through digital retail. New cast members revealed for Red Alert 3: Uprising


We were told last week that Electronic Arts' upcoming downloadable stand alone RTS game Command and Conquer Red Alert 3: Uprising would have some new cast members for its live action cut scenes. Today Eurogamer revealed one of those new actors: Holly Valance, who plays a reporter with the almost porn-like name of Brenda Snow. The Australian-born actor is best known in the States for her recurring role in Prison Break and for playing Christie in the Dead or Alive movie (which we secretly love, by the way).

In Eurogamer's brief interview with Valance she also revealed yet another actor that will appear in Uprising; none other than Malcolm McDowell who has perhaps made more B-grade movies than anyone alive and has been good in all of them. We won't mention his character since it might be considered a spoiler for Red Alert 3's storyline. Just trust us on this.
